qpsk的costas解调器
时间: 2023-08-05 10:07:53 浏览: 54
QPSK的Costas解调器是一种数字信号处理系统,用于从QPSK调制信号中恢复出基带信号。它的基本原理是利用Costas环路来恢复相位和频率信息,从而实现解调。
Costas环路是一种带有相位锁定的环路,其输入信号为接收到的QPSK信号。在环路中,信号被分成两个分支,一个分支用于相位检测,另一个分支用于频率检测。相位检测器将输入信号与本地载波相乘得到一个相位差信号,频率检测器则通过对相位差信号进行积分和滤波来检测频率差异。然后,通过反馈控制,环路中的本地载波频率和相位被调整,直到与接收到的信号相匹配。
通过这种方式,Costas解调器能够有效地恢复出原始的基带信号,从而实现解调。
相关问题
基于FPGA的带通QPSK调制解调器设计
FPGA是一种可编程逻辑器件,可以实现数字信号处理功能,而带通QPSK调制解调器是一种数字通信系统,它可以在带宽有限的信道中传输高速数据。因此,基于FPGA的带通QPSK调制解调器设计是可以实现的。
设计该调制解调器的关键是实现QPSK调制和解调算法。QPSK调制是通过将每个符号映射为四个不同的相位来实现的,而QPSK解调是通过将接收到的信号与本地参考信号进行相位比较来实现的。为了实现这些算法,需要在FPGA中实现相应的数字信号处理模块。
在设计带通QPSK调制解调器时,需要考虑以下因素:
1. 选取合适的FPGA芯片,该芯片需要具备足够的计算能力和存储容量,以支持各种数字信号处理算法。
2. 实现QPSK调制和解调器算法,包括符号映射、相位比较、滤波器设计等。
3. 设计合适的传输信道模型,以便在实验中对调制解调器进行测试。
4. 实现相应的控制模块,以便对调制解调器进行配置和控制。
总之,基于FPGA的带通QPSK调制解调器设计是一项复杂的任务,需要深入理解数字信号处理和通信系统原理,并具备相应的硬件设计和编程技能。
QPSK调制解调器的设计及FPGA实现
QPSK调制解调器的设计及FPGA实现可以通过以下步骤完成。首先,将输入的数据进行串/并转换,然后对其进行单/双极性变换,得到双比特码元。这些码元将形成I路和Q路两路的信号。接下来,通过滤波器对这两路信号进行滤波处理。然后,进行调制,即将I路信号与cos相乘,将Q路信号与sin相乘。接着,对两路输出进行混频处理,以产生QPSK的中频信号。这个中频信号可以通过FPGA实现。在FPGA中,可以使用硬件描述语言(如Verilog或VHDL)来描述QPSK调制解调器的功能。通过将这个描述编译成FPGA可执行的二进制文件,可以将QPSK调制解调器的功能实现在FPGA芯片上。这样,就可以在FPGA上实现QPSK调制解调器的设计。\[1\]\[2\]\[3\]
#### 引用[.reference_title]
- *1* *2* [【FPGA教程案例79】通信案例5——基于FPGA的QPSK调制解调系统实现](https://blog.csdn.net/ccsss22/article/details/126825774)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
- *3* [基于FPGA的QPSK调制解调-------(1)QPSK调制技术的原理](https://blog.csdn.net/youshenglv/article/details/128033502)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]